Rashid Al Dhaheri becomes first driver from the Arab World to make it to the Ferrari Driver Academy Scouting World Finals

Abu Dhabi – Maranello, 18th October 2022: – One month ahead of Abu Dhabi’s Formula 1 Grand Prix, UAE’s international karting champion Rashid Al Dhaheri, has become the first Arab driver to reach the Ferrari Driver Academy (FDA) Scouting World Finals.

The 2022 edition of the FDA Scouting World Finals is the pinnacle for all young race drivers, with the last stage taking place at Ferrari’s headquarters in Via Enzo Ferrari at Maranello, Italy.

The winner of the Scouting World Finals will join the prestigious Ferrari Driver Academy, the world’s oldest and most well-known Formula 1 academy. Drivers who have come through the academy include latest superstar, the never forgotten Jules Bianchi, Charles Leclerc, but also Sergio Perez, Mick Schumacher, Lance Stroll, and Guanyu Zhou.

Rashid will spend the last week of October with five other young contenders at the Scuderia Ferrari, the division of Ferrari’s automobile company concerned with racing. He will be analyzed, checked, and assessed by numerous Ferrari specialists in a series of tests to evaluate his physical and attitudinal abilities as well as his mental suitability for a rigorous life in racing, both on and off track.

The young Emirati champion, Rashid Al Dhaheri, will also tackle simulator sessions and take part in tests at the famous Fiorano track – Ferrari’s home racetrack – at the wheel of a Formula 4 racing car. At the end of the week the Ferrari experts will decide who will be allowed to join FDA and start a tough program which has one goal: racing for the Prancing Horse in Formula 1.

About Rashid Al Dhaheri

Rashid Al Dhaheri’s passion for motorsports started from a very young age, growing up just 10 minutes away from Yas Marina Formula 1 circuit, which ignited his passion. After some practice sessions, he attended a karting summer camp in Italy organized by the Italian Karting & Motorsport Federation (ACI-CSAI). Here he immediately demonstrated an aptitude for racing and considerable natural talent.

Rashid has rapidly developed into a young karting racing star who continuously achieves a string of firsts for the Arab world. In March 2019, the young Emirati became the first person from both the Middle East and Asia to became champion of the World Series. He won the championship with a big margin and became the first Mini driver to win three out of four races in the last seven years. Rashid added to this the prestigious WSK Euro Series Championship and won in 2021 another double Championship in the World Series Champions Cup and the World Series Super Series in the fiercly fought OK-Junior category, apart from winning the world’s greatest karting race in Macao.
